dc.description.abstract | Signed at end: By Captain John Bulmer Engineer. Imprint from Wing. With: 'A true copy of a certificate from Emmanuel Colledge in Cambridge 1646.', signed by Lawrence Sarson, Ralph Cudworth, and William Dillingham; and a poem 'To the states of England'. Annotation on Thomason copy: "Nouemb. 8 1649". Reproduction of the original in the British Library. |
